Replacement

Modern key fobs make it simple to start your car or unlock the doors. But like any gadget, they have a limited life span. It may be time to replace the battery in your Nissan Intelligent Key remote if it starts acting up. If your fob is dead and you are left without a replacement, you could be in a bind in the event that you have to go to work near Detroit, run some essential errands in Southfield or spend night out near Troy.

It's easy to replace nissan key fob the battery on your Nissan Intelligent Key. Begin by flipping your key fob and then pushing small sliders on the back. This will open the back portion of the fob, revealing the hidden mechanical key within. You'll have to remove this key prior to proceeding with the battery replacement.

Next, locate an opening on the top of the fob. Use a screwdriver with a flat head to turn it. This will split the fob's casing into two pieces, allowing you to remove the old battery and replace it with a new one. Note the position of the battery that was removed. You'll need to place the new one at the same location to ensure that the fob is working correctly. After putting in the new battery, you can clip the two parts of your Nissan Intelligent Key back together and test it out to see if it works as expected.
